The Japanese built more of the Type 1 Attack bomber (allied code named "Betty") than any other bomber during World War II. From the first day of war until after the surrender, BETTY bombers saw service throughout the Pacific and Indian Oceans.
The new Betty Bomber from Minicraft features new markings representing the Imperial Japanese Navy aircraft that carried Admiral Yamamoto to his last inspection tour. The Japanese aircraft were shot down by USAAF P-38 fighters during a daring intercept mission in 1943. This kit features high-quality decals printed by Cartograf, pre-decorated clear parts and the new Minicraft clear stand for display "in flight".
